Nishan Silva ( MBBS ) Oesophagus – Normal Anatomy • Extends from Pharynx (C6) to Gastro oesophageal junction (T11/T12) • 25.0 cm in length. • 3 points of narrowing Cricoid cartilage L/S Bronchus Diaphragm. • UES – 3cm segment at the cricopharyngeal muscle. • LES – 2 – 4 cm segment in the abdomen proximal to the anatomical GE sphincter. Esophageal Anatomy Upper Esophageal Sphincter (UES) Esophageal Body (cervical & thoracic) Lower Esophageal Sphincter (LES) 18 to 24 cm Oesophagus - Histology • Mucosa – non keratinizing squamous epithelium. • Submucosa – loose Connective tissue. • Muscularis propria – Inner – circular – Outer – Longitudinal Skeletal mm fibres in the initial 10 – 12 cms. Achalasia Cardia Achalasia cardia • Failure of the cardia (LES) to open when the peristaltic wave reaches it. • Major abnormalities in the Achalasia cardia Aperistalsis Partial / complete relaxation of LES Increased basal tone of LES Achalasia cardia • Symptoms – Progressive dysphagia. Regurgitation of undigested food. Aspiration pneumonia. Retrosternal discomfort. Foetid flatulence. Achalasia cardia - Pathology • Progressive dilatation of the upper segment • Wall – thickened proximally due to muscular hypertrophy. – Wall thinned out due to dilatation. – Normal in thickness • Ganglia – absent in upper segment. • Ulceration and inflammation of the oesophageal lining. Hiatus Hernia Hiatus Hernia • Sliding type – Disturbance of the normal relationship of the gastro oesophageal junction. Reflux. • Paraoesophageal / rolling type – Strangulation & Obstruction. Ulceration of the Oesophagus • Mallory – Weiss Syndrome – ( laceration / tear) • Oesophagitis. Mallory – Weiss Syndrome • Tear in the oesophageal mucosa which is oriented longitudinally astride the oesophagogastric junction: Common in alcoholics. Life style - Alcohol, Tobacco – 4, Genetic - Epidermolysis Bullosa, Coeliac disease, Ectodermal dysplasia Clinical features • PROGRESSIVE DYSPHAGIA UNTIL PROVED OTHERWISE IS CARCINOMA OESOPHAGUS • Regurgitation. • Pain • Loss of weight - BUT NOT LOSS OF APPETITE. Morphology • Site - Commonest in the middle 3rd. • Macroscopy – 1. Polypoidal fungating. ) 15% – 2. Nodular mass. ) – 3. Diffuse infiltrative - flat lesion. – 4. Excavated /ulcerated – Superficial (in -situ) Macroscopic Appearances Microscopy • Squamous carcinoma. – Cell keratinization – Intercellular bridges /prickles. – Keratin pearls. Metastases • Blood stream spread is uncommon. - Lung Brain & Bone • Lymph node – Upper 3rd - Cervical – Middle 3rd - Mediastinal, tracheobronchial, paratracheal – Lower 3rd - Gastric & Coeliac node. Causes of Death • Starvation & wasting. • Tracheo-oesophageal fistula - Aspiration pneumonia. • Rupture - Mediastinitis. • Haemorrhage • Distant spread.
